We changed the defaults for the translation-string extraction script. Previously, `extract-strings` scanned only `src/` and ignored template partials, which caused missing keys in the Varnholm dashboard locale bundles. It now walks all workspace packages, includes `.tpl` partials, and writes merged catalogs atomically. Plural-form detection is on by default; opt out per package if needed. Teams should re-run extraction before Thursday's freeze. The current defaults shipped with the service are as follows.

deployment values, tafof-taduf:
pelius:
  pin: 6508
  tenant: praiel
  seal: seal_4e33a2f4
  metrics_host: metrics.pelius.plorvagrid.corp
  standby_team: druix
  escalation: juldor-norius
  nonce: 5db598

Step 6 — Widegap diff viewer rollout. After the chunked-rendering tests pass, promote the build to the canary ring and watch memory on files over 200 MB. If the canary holds for one hour, proceed to full rollout. Publishing to the internal registry requires signing the package with the key below.

release key, kawif-hawep: bky13_X7TGuRG4Zu4ZJ

Ticket #—: Data-centre cage visit. Hi reception folks — two engineers from Vantrell Systems are coming Thursday morning to swap drives in our cage at the Dunmorrow facility. Please sign them in as usual, check photo ID, and ring the ops room so someone walks them down. They'll need about two hours. Don't let them wander the corridor unescorted. The cage-door entry code for the escort is below.

staff pass of kawip-hawef = bdg-QLP-2